’Lucida’ is a network of lens-based new media artists. We are a collective of recent NCAD graduates navigating what it means to sustain an artistic practice. We emerged from the Clancy-Quay Professional Development Programme during the early Covid-19 lockdowns. ‘Lucida’ embraces the fluidity of our making and the equally changeable world it's embedded in. It was formed as a collaborative space. Within ‘Lucida’, we create connection during isolation, tangibility in virtual space and work to adapt to our new, precarious world.
‘Lucida’ becomes a frame to lean into, somewhere to support each other and our practices. It is a personal and artistic network of care. We connect across each corner of Ireland through weekly zoom conversations, crits and collaborations. All of 'Lucida's' practical support and creative imaginings begin with discussion, and we let our direction organically grow from there. Our points of discussion become sharing research and opportunities, which turn into tangible, collaborative artworks and evolve into zines and exhibitions. Each project directly engages with the world we live in; whether as Covid-19 postal artworks or zines with Augmented Reality extensions.
As individuals our work spans the breadth of lens-based media; photography to video, installation to VR/3D modelling. Our mediums are as varied as our conceptual interests. As artists we are distinct and individual, within ‘Lucida’ we are connected by our collective strengths. We acknowledge the hybridised forms our practices embrace and create a space for them to be nurtured through the collective. ‘Lucida’ becomes a collaborative space, project and process. We are interested in ideas and unfinished drafts, multiplicity and growth over finitude and finished objects. We ascribe to Peter Osborne's idea of the artwork as a 'process' of 'infinite becomings'.
